S06958 Summary:

BILL NOS06958
 
SAME ASSAME AS A07001
 
SPONSORBORRELLO
 
COSPNSR
 
MLTSPNSR
 
Add 13, Exec L
 
Requires withholding the governor's salary until the legislative passage of the budget occurs.

S06958 Text:



 
                STATE OF NEW YORK
        ________________________________________________________________________
 
                                          6958
 
                               2023-2024 Regular Sessions
 
                    IN SENATE
 
                                      May 16, 2023
                                       ___________
 
        Introduced  by Sen. BORRELLO -- read twice and ordered printed, and when
          printed to be committed to the Committee on Finance
 
        AN ACT to amend the executive law, in relation to payment of the  gover-
          nor's salary
 
          The  People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:

     1    Section 1. The executive law is amended by adding a new section 13  to
     2  read as follows:
     3    §  13.  Compensation  of the governor. 1. Effective January first, two
     4  thousand twenty-four, the governor of the state of New York  shall  have
     5  the net payment of his or her salary, as provided in article four of the
     6  state  constitution  and fixed by the legislature, withheld and not paid
     7  until legislative passage of the budget is complete, if the  legislative
     8  passage  of  the  budget, as defined in subdivision two of this section,
     9  has not occurred prior to the first day of any fiscal  year.  An  amount
    10  equal  to the accrued, withheld and unpaid amount shall be promptly paid
    11  to the governor upon passage of the legislative budget.
    12    2. For the purposes of this section:
    13    (a) "net payment" shall mean gross salary minus  any  or  all  of  the
    14  following deductions: federal taxes, state taxes, social security taxes,
    15  city  taxes,  payments  on  retirement  loans, retirement contributions,
    16  contributions to health insurance or  other  group  insurance  programs,
    17  child support and court ordered payments; and
    18    (b)  "legislative passage of the budget" shall mean that the appropri-
    19  ation bill or bills submitted by the governor pursuant to section  three
    20  of article seven of the state constitution have been finally acted on by
    21  both  houses  of the legislature in accordance with article seven of the
    22  state constitution and the state comptroller has  determined  that  such
    23  appropriation  bill  or  bills  that  have  been finally acted on by the
    24  legislature are sufficient for the  ongoing  operation  and  support  of
    25  state government and local assistance for the ensuing fiscal year.
    26    §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
